网站首页 站内搜索

搜索结果

查询Tags标签: 简析,共有 44条记录
  • 简析Linux内核中断机制

    目录一、背景介绍二、基本原理三、分类四、中断流程接受中断信号查找向量表五、exception/异常六、interrupt/中断1、hardirq2、softirq七、中断与同步八、参考资料 一、背景介绍 1、什么是中断?为什么要有中断? 2、中断完整流程是什么? 3、中断为什么要分上下半部? 4…

    2022/9/5 5:52:49 人评论 次浏览
  • 服务端高性能网络IO编程模型简析

    服务端高性能网络IO编程模型简析 一、客户端与服务器端 多数网络应用可以分为客户端(client)和服务器端(server)模型,然后中间通过各种定义的协议来进行两端的通信。比如常用的 Nginx 软件。可以把它当做一个 web 服务器。我们可以在 web 浏览器(客户端)与 Nginx 进行通信…

    2022/8/15 14:53:51 人评论 次浏览
  • 【转载】Linux RTC简析及使用

    转载原文地址: https://blog.csdn.net/spongebob1912/article/details/111174475背景 对Linux时间系统感兴趣不是一天两天了,今天这篇着重讲一下Linux时间系统中相对简单跟独立的部分——RTC。 简述 RTC全称为Real Time Clock,是一个专门用来记录时间的硬件设备,一般可…

    2022/7/21 5:23:52 人评论 次浏览
  • 基于多传感器融合的贵重物品定位管理物联网解决方案简析

    现实问题朋友A要把他的贵重的一幅字画运送到远在千里之外的新家,虽然找了物流公司,他仍然不放心,万一被弄丢了或者损坏了咋办?能否帮我开发一个跟踪设备?可以实时记录货物的状态以及地址?出了意外的情况下发出报警信号?朋友B是一个牛贩子。他经常深入西北的大山去买…

    2022/7/9 23:22:16 人评论 次浏览
  • 减少仔猪的挤压死亡率的可穿戴设备简析

    在商业农场中,母猪压死小猪的情况经常发生。根据统计,大约每10头仔猪中就有1头被母猪挤压致死,在有机农场内,这种意外情况发生的频率更高。 根据爱荷华农业科技创业公司SwineTech的统计数据,仅在2016年,母猪挤压就导致了美国1300万头仔猪和全球1.16亿头仔猪的死亡,…

    2022/7/5 23:23:09 人评论 次浏览
  • php底层结构原理简析

    用了这么多年php,底层原理我其实自己还是没完全吃透。这里简单记录一下php的底层结构和工作原理,用于记录: php是一种适用于web开发的动态弱类型语言,它的底层是用c语言实现的。 1、特点: 多进程模型:php是多进程模型,各请求之间互不干涉,这样保证了每一个请求不会…

    2022/6/24 14:21:55 人评论 次浏览
  • 简析java中的正则表达式

    一、简介 正则表达式可以用字符串来描述规则,并用来匹配字符串。 使用正则表达式的好处有哪些?一个正则表达式就是一个描述规则的字符串,所以,只需要编写正确的规则,我们就可以让正则表达式引擎去判断目标字符串是否符合规则。 正则表达式是一套标准,它可以用于任何…

    2022/6/1 1:19:41 人评论 次浏览
  • Java ThreadLocal 类简析

    ThreadLocal ThreadLocal 类的作用就是实现每一个线程都有自己的专属本地变量。 使用 简单示例 public class Demo01 implements Runnable {// SimpleDateFormat 不是线程安全的,所以每个线程都要有自己独立的副本private static final ThreadLocal<SimpleDateFormat&…

    2022/5/27 1:20:04 人评论 次浏览
  • 11 netty中NioEventLoop源码简析

    1 概述 1-1 成分分析 前置知识ExecutorService: Interface ExecutorService ThreadPoolExecutor 常识:ExecutorService是线程池生命周期管理(创建,执行,关闭)的工具类 JDK中ExecutorService接口的实现类 AbstractExecutorService, ForkJoinPool, ScheduledThreadPool…

    2022/4/26 14:42:48 人评论 次浏览
  • APP路由框架与组件化简析,腾讯架构师深入讲解Android开发

    第二步:调用 void jumpSecondActivityUseFilter() { Intent intent = new Intent(); intent.setAction(“com.snail.activityforresultexample.SecondActivity”); startActivity(intent); } 如果牵扯到数据传递写法上会更复杂一些,隐式调用的缺点有如下几点:首先manif…

    2022/3/2 23:17:10 人评论 次浏览
  • 简析 Linux 下的 bashrc 和 profile 的差异

    1. bashrc是在系统启动后就会自动运行。 2. profile是在用户登录后才会运行,常在/etc/profile文件中修改环境变量,在这里修改的内容是对所有用户起作用的。3. 在profile文件添加或修改的内容需要注销系统才能生效。4. 进行设置后,可运用source bashrc命令更新bashrc,也…

    2022/2/19 7:12:09 人评论 次浏览
  • linux网络流控-htb算法简析

    linux网络流控-htb算法简析confirmwz于 2019-04-18 08:32:52 发布1847 收藏 4分类专栏: QOSQOS专栏收录该内容 14 篇文章3 订阅 订阅专栏项目中用tc,htb做流控期间,研究了htb(分层令牌桶)算法的实现.觉得这种思想在类似与有消费优先级的生产者消费者场景中也很适用.该算法…

    2022/2/16 7:11:40 人评论 次浏览
  • 【概念简析】浅谈Java SPI机制的理解及应用

    Java SPI(Service Provider Interface),是JDK提供的一套用来被第三方实现或者扩展的接口,通过java.util.ServiceLoader类加载META-INF/services/中的配置进行服务发现,可以用来启用框架扩展和替换组件。主要好处在于解耦,可拔插,面向接口编程,本质是基于接口的编程…

    2022/2/10 22:16:15 人评论 次浏览
  • 简析回溯算法

    回溯算法 非常好用的一种算法。通俗的来说就是将所有的数据转化为树形结构,依次往下走,走不下去可以退回去的一种算法。 例子1 数组返回不同排列的值 给定一个可重复的数组,按照不同的顺序组合成不同的集合,有多少种。分别是什么? int scores2[] = new int[]{1,2,3};…

    2021/12/16 22:17:11 人评论 次浏览
  • 简析回溯算法

    回溯算法 非常好用的一种算法。通俗的来说就是将所有的数据转化为树形结构,依次往下走,走不下去可以退回去的一种算法。 例子1 数组返回不同排列的值 给定一个可重复的数组,按照不同的顺序组合成不同的集合,有多少种。分别是什么? int scores2[] = new int[]{1,2,3};…

    2021/12/16 22:17:11 人评论 次浏览
共44记录«上一页123下一页»
扫一扫关注最新编程教程